Understanding the Basics of Website Restoration

Website restoration is the process of recovering a website’s useful content, structure, and function after it has been lost, damaged, neglected, or left outdated. In plain terms, it is the work of deciding what should be preserved, what must be rebuilt, and what should be retired so the site can serve visitors again.

The question is not simply whether a site can be brought back. The better question is whether it can be restored in a way that is accurate, usable, and maintainable. That distinction matters, because copying a broken site without improving its weak points is less restoration than repetition.

What Website Restoration Means

Website restoration sits somewhere between disaster recovery and redesign. It can involve bringing back missing pages, reconnecting media files, rebuilding navigation, restoring a database, fixing a failed update, or recreating a site from surviving materials such as backups, documentation, and archived captures.

Preservation matters here. Public web content can disappear quietly: a hosting account lapses, a content management system breaks after an update, a redesign removes valuable pages, or a domain changes hands. Public tools such as the Internet Archive’s Wayback Machine and institutional efforts such as the Library of Congress Web Archiving Program exist for a reason. The web forgets faster than most teams expect.

For a business or organization, restoration is not only about nostalgia. It is about continuity. Visitors still need working pages, clear navigation, current contact paths, and confidence that the information on the site is still trustworthy. Why Websites Need Restoration

Most restoration projects begin for one of four reasons:

Reason What it usually looks like Main risk if ignored
Technical failure Broken updates, database errors, missing files, or a failed migration Downtime, broken pages, and lost visitor trust
Content loss Deleted pages, missing media, or a redesign that removed useful material Lost search visibility and weaker public usefulness
Preservation Saving historically or operationally important information before it disappears Permanent loss of reference material and organizational memory
Usability repair Restoring a site whose structure, links, or layout no longer work for modern visitors Visitors leave even if the content technically still exists

A small business site that vanished after a hosting lapse is one common case. Another is an organization that still has the written content but not the original theme, forms, or navigation. In both situations, the restoration goal is similar: recover the material that still matters, then rebuild the delivery system so people can actually use it.

There is also a quieter reason: accountability. If a site published guidance, policies, community resources, or product information, letting all of that disappear may create confusion for users who still rely on it. Restoration helps hold the line between a temporary failure and a permanent disappearance.

The Core Steps in a Restoration Project

A practical restoration process usually follows a simple order.

1. Assess what still exists

Start with an inventory. List the pages, files, databases, forms, and integrations you still have. Then separate them into three groups: intact, partially recoverable, and missing. This step sounds administrative because it is. It is also where expensive mistakes are prevented.

2. Secure backups and recovery sources

Before changing anything, make a full backup of the current state, even if the site is already broken. You need a stable rollback point. If the site runs on WordPress, the official WordPress backup documentation is a useful baseline for what to preserve. Beyond local backups, teams often pull from hosting snapshots, exported databases, version control, cloud storage, and archived public copies.

3. Decide what should be restored exactly and what should be modernized

This is the decision point many teams skip. Not every old layout, plugin, or page deserves an exact return. A reasonable default is to preserve the content and intent first, then modernize the parts that were already fragile. Old navigation labels, outdated scripts, and dead forms rarely improve with age.

4. Rebuild the site structure

Once priorities are clear, restore the pages, menus, images, and templates that still matter. Test each major path: home, about, contact, key resources, search, and mobile layout. If the site is large, rebuild the highest-value sections first rather than trying to relaunch everything at once.

5. Test before relaunch

Check links, forms, image loading, page speed, and basic accessibility. The point is not perfection on day one. It is to avoid restoring a site that looks complete but fails the first visitor who actually tries to use it.

Real-World Patterns Worth Noticing

Public preservation projects show that restoration is not only an emergency response. It is also an ongoing discipline. The Digital Preservation Coalition handbook makes the broader point well: long-term access depends on planning, documentation, and repeated maintenance rather than one heroic rescue.

In smaller projects, the pattern is usually simpler. A team recovers old content from a backup or archived copy, realizes the original structure was harder to maintain than expected, and uses the restoration window to simplify. That is often the right move. Not all victories require rebuilding every historical quirk.

Best Practices for Effective Website Restoration

  • Keep regular backups. Backups reduce restoration from a crisis project to a controlled task.
  • Document the stack. Record themes, plugins, hosting settings, domains, and third-party integrations before they become guesswork.
  • Restore in priority order. Start with the pages and functions visitors rely on most.
  • Use trustworthy tools. Stable hosting, reliable backup systems, and a documented CMS setup are better than improvised fixes.
  • Separate preservation from redesign. First recover what matters, then improve the presentation with a clearer scope.
  • Review the site after launch. Restoration is complete only when the rebuilt version is easier to maintain than the broken one it replaced.

A Reasonable Default

If you are approaching a restoration for the first time, choose the safest reasonable default: recover the essential content, verify the backups, rebuild the navigation and templates cleanly, and remove anything that no longer serves visitors. Website restoration works best when it is guided by criteria rather than panic.

That may sound less dramatic than a full digital resurrection, but it is usually the better fit. The goal is not to prove that every file can be saved. The goal is to restore a site people can trust and a team can keep alive.
